PVC film facing material has the real wood grain feeling, high wear resistance strength, soft gloss and widely used in wooden furniture surface decoration [. But PVC film and plank have low degree of adhesive; water will open in bubble shortcomings. And butyl acrylic, vinyl acetate copolymer emulsion and have good adhesive sex and peel strength, and it has better cohesion[.This article describes the modified acrylic adhesive vinyl acetate synthesis methods and performance characteristics that affect the performance of some of the major factors, namely raw material ratio, the amount of initiator, polymerization temperature, add water, put forward various factors on product performance cause and effect, and how to improve product performance were discussed. Analysis of the response characteristics of acrylic ester, acrylic acid ester described the main components of raw materials and application of several adhesive, tells today of Propylene. Ester adhesive research trends and research progress. In addition to the acryl ate modified vinyl acetate adhesive preparation and distribution of each group than to its solid content, initial viscosity, viscosity can be held, 180-degree peel strength of the main physical properties[. With the change in the distribution ratio of each group, the physical properties of its corresponding change took place, after joining EHA modified acrylic adhesive vinyl acetate also increased the initial viscosity. With the change in component modified vinyl acetate acrylic adhesive solid content and viscosity are held to change[.Idea vinyl acetate adhesive properties of the impact of factors related to the quality of acrylic acid, the ratio of butyl acryl ate and ethyl acetate, PVA's quality[. The results show that when the initiator was ammonium per sulfate (APS), the acrylic acid quality is 4, the ratio of butyl acryl ate and ethyl acetate 30:70, PVA modified by a mass of 8 180 vinyl adhesive peel strength largest, best quality plastic. Preparation of rubber modified vinyl acetate preferably 180 ° peel strength, holding the maximum viscosity, the measured test results of the best.Key words: Acryl ate; acryl ate modified vinyl acetate adhesives; holding viscous energy; 180 ° peel strength;
